Analysis

In 2025, urban population in Greece stood at 8.25 million.

The figure is up 0.4% on the previous year and down 1.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, urban population in Greece peaked at 8.51 million in 2011 and was at its lowest, 4.65 million, in 1960.

That places Greece 75th out of 215 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 66 years of available data.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 5.08 million 4.65 million 5.57 million 10
1970s 6.09 million 5.66 million 6.60 million 10
1980s 6.98 million 6.70 million 7.20 million 10
1990s 7.58 million 7.29 million 7.80 million 10
2000s 8.14 million 7.85 million 8.44 million 10
2010s 8.43 million 8.37 million 8.51 million 10
2020s 8.26 million 8.20 million 8.38 million 6

Urban population refers to people living in urban areas as defined by national statistical offices. It is calculated using World Bank population estimates and urban ratios from the United Nations World Urbanization Prospects. Aggregation of urban and rural population may not add up to total population because of different country coverages.
